thệ sư
[tʰe˧˨ʔ sɨ˧˧]
In real, traceable use. Part of the curated seed collection; community review is coming.
Meaning · English
(noun) rally to pledge resolution before going to war
Noun
Where it’s used:
Used
Toàn quốc & hải ngoại · Vietnam-wide & diaspora
Examples
lễ thệ sưmilitary oath-taking ceremony
Nguyễn Huệ đã tổ chức hàng loạt động tác nghi binh như viết thư cầu hoà, "diễu binh" toàn người già và trẻ con, lễ thệ sư, vv.Nguyễn Huệ organized a series of diversionary moves: he wrote a letter suing for peace, "paraded" old people and children, held an oath-taking ceremony, etc.
